Catalytic selective epoxidation of mixed biolefins with air over nanosized Co3O4 catalyst under mild ultrasonic conditions has been first reported. When the styrene/alpha-pinene molar ratio was 1:5, the highest conversions were, respectively, reached 81.8 mol% for styrene and 76.1 mol% for alpha-pinene, with the epoxidation selectivity of 84.1% (styrene oxide) and 94.6% (alpha-pinene oxide), notably higher than those of the conventional reactions under magnetic stirring. An intermolecular electron-transfer phenomenon between conjugated styrene and electron-rich alpha-pinene was revealed by UV-vis spectra, which was considerably important for the enhancement of reactivities of both olefinic molecules observed experimentally.
